Paramagnetic ring currents in the carbanion of 5H-dibenzo [a,d] cycloheptene and the nitranion of 5H-dibenz[b,f] azepine
Authors:H.W. Vos  Y.W. Bakker  C. Maclean  N.H. Velthorst
Affiliation:Chemical Laboratory of the Free University, Amsterdam The Netherlands
Abstract:The proton NMR spectra of the carbanion of 5H-dibenzo[a, d] cycloheptene (DbcH?) and the nitranion of 5H-dibenz[b, f] azepine (Dba?) have been recorded and interpreted. Numerical values for the ring current in each ring have been estimated by a least squares analysis of the observed chemical shifts, after applying corrections for the excess charges and local electric dipoles. The results point to a strong paramagnetic ring current in the seven-membered ring, the one in DbcH? being larger than in Dba?.
